Russia's hydrofluoric acid market is valued at USD 68.5 million in 2025, with a projected growth to USD 75.0 million by 2030, reflecting a CAGR of 1.85%.
Demand is primarily driven by fluorochemical production, petroleum refining operations, and uranium enrichment sectors, which collectively represent Russia's largest consumption segments.
Russia maintains a mature and stable hydrofluoric acid market with established supply chains and production capabilities supporting domestic industrial demand.
The modest 1.85% CAGR reflects Russia's established market maturity and slower expansion compared to the global market's 4.58% growth rate.

| Segment | 2024 | 2025 | 2026 | 2027 | 2028 | 2029 | 2030 | CAGR (%)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| GLASS ETCHING & CLEANING | 4.1 | 4.1 | 4.2 | 4.3 | 4.3 | 4.4 | 4.5 | 1.54 |
| METAL PICKLING | 5.3 | 5.4 | 5.5 | 5.5 | 5.6 | 5.7 | 5.8 | 1.59 |
| OIL REFINING | 3.8 | 3.9 | 3.9 | 4 | 4 | 4.1 | 4.1 | 1.3 |
| OTHER APPLICATIONS | 1.9 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2.1 | 1.07 |
| PRODUCTION OF FLUORINATED DERIVATIVES | 11.3 | 11.5 | 11.8 | 12 | 12.3 | 12.5 | 12.8 | 2.1 |
| PRODUCTION OF FLUOROCARBONS | 37.9 | 38.7 | 39.5 | 40.2 | 41 | 41.8 | 42.7 | 1.98 |
| PRODUCTION OF URANIUM FUEL | 2.9 | 2.9 | 2.9 | 3 | 3 | 3 | 3.1 | 1.19 |
| TOTAL | 67.2 | 68.5 | 69.7 | 71 | 72.3 | 73.7 | 75 | 1.85 |

The reaction between a hydrogen atom and a fluorine atom produces hydrogen fluoride, a colorless, corrosive liquid or vapor with a strong, unpleasant, pungent odor. Hydrofluoric acid forms when hydrogen fluoride dissolves in water. The report divides the hydrofluoric acid market based on its grades, applications, and regions. It is available in different grades depending on the acid's concentration levels. In terms of its uses, hydrofluoric acid is employed in several industries, such as chemical manufacturing and glass etching.
